Technological Catalysts Enabling Underwater Excellence

Technological Advancement Impact on Underwater Games
Real-Time Ray Tracing Enhances visual fidelity of water surfaces, realistic light refraction, and aquatic flora and fauna.
High-Resolution VR headsets Offers fully immersive experiences, transporting players into vibrant coral reefs and deep-sea environments.
Procedural Generation Allows for expansive, dynamic ocean landscapes that evolve with gameplay, enhancing replayability and exploration depth.

Audience Engagement and Cultural Significance

„Underwater settings tap into a universal sense of wonder and curiosity, making them ideal for engaging diverse audiences across age groups.“ – Dr. Emily Carter, Gaming Industry Analyst

The thematic richness of aquatic environments offers fertile ground for storytelling, environmental education, and social interaction. For instance, conservation-focused games encourage players to learn about oceanic ecosystems, inspiring real-world awareness. Moreover, the recurrent popularity of underwater levels in popular franchises indicates their cultural resonance, serving as both nostalgic callbacks and innovative frontiers.
